Former world champion Alex Arthur believes WBO lightweight king Ricky Burns (35-2, 10KOs) needs bigger fights. He says the previously scheduled matches with Jose Ocampo, and Liam Walsh, were below the proper standards of who the champion should be fighting.

"It doesn't look good. You would think he would have a named opponent by now - and a top caliber name," said Arthur to BBC Scotland.

"The two matches that were made for him were relatively small by his standards. I think Ricky will want bigger fights than that. It's really important for him that he competes at a higher level than the fights he's recently been scheduled at."

There were discussions to make a unification with WBC champion Adrien Broner, but the two sides could not agree on the financial terms.
